Ethernet Settings

In the RealPresence Collaboration Server (RMX) 1500/4000 the automatically identified
speed and transmit/receive mode of each LAN port used by the system can be manually
modified if the specific switch requires it. These settings can be modified in the Ethernet
Settings dialog box and they are not part of the Management Network dialog box as for the
RealPresence Collaboration Server (RMX) 2000.
RealPresence Collaboration Server (RMX) 1500: The Port numbers displayed in the dialog box
do not reflect the physical Port numbers as labeled on the RealPresence Collaboration Server
(RMX) 1500.
Table 16-14 shows the physical mapping of Port Type to the physical label on the back panel
of the RealPresence Collaboration Server (RMX) 1500.
